Navy tasked to adopt unmanned systems advisory panel recommendations in POM-27

By Jason Sherman / January 31, 2025 at 2:22 PM
Navy leadership has tasked the service to accept recommendations of an influential advisory panel to rapidly accelerate adoption of uncrewed systems as part of the fiscal year 2027 planning cycle, including providing $100 million to support "commercial tech scouting and delivery to the fleet."
